作者yoche2000 (综合焦虑症候群)
看板Network
标题[问答] BPDU 为甚麽不 tag
时间Sat Oct 7 05:24:59 2023
STP Frame 的 BPDU 在 priority 上是以 4096 为 increment 的,
原因是因为那 12 bit 要给 VLAN ID 用,因为可能有多个 ST for VLANs,
(原因是 STP 在 L2 都会是 untagged [1])
所以在 VLAN1 的实际 priority 就会是 4096*n + 1。
既然是要标示 VLAN 用,那为甚麽不直接用 Ethernet 的 VLAN Tag 的就好,
要跟 priority 借 12 位元? 这是 Dsign by Choice 吗?
[1]
https://bit.ly/3PJBrGv
--
◥ ◢◥ KPOPCAST - PTTer 的 KPOP PODCAST ◢██◤
◢◤ ◥◣ ◥◣ ───────────────── ◢█◥ ◢█◤ ◣
◢ █ █ ◆ 最全面、深入的 KPOP 议题讨论 ◤ █ █
◣◥ ◢◤█◣◢◤ ◆ 快速认识艺人、深度解析作品 █ ◢█◣◥◣ ◥
◥ ◣█ █ █ ◆ 一周所需的 KPOP 资讯整理&预测 █ ◣ ◤ █ █
◣ ◣ ◥◢█ https://www.youtube.com/@kpopcast ◥█◤◥◣◥◤ ◥
--
※ 发信站: 批踢踢实业坊(ptt.cc), 来自: 152.7.255.192 (美国)
※ 文章网址: https://webptt.com/cn.aspx?n=bbs/Network/M.1696627503.A.A67.html
※ 编辑: yoche2000 (152.7.255.192 美国), 10/07/2023 05:26:11
※ 编辑: yoche2000 (152.7.255.192 美国), 10/07/2023 05:26:59
※ 编辑: yoche2000 (152.7.255.192 美国), 10/07/2023 05:27:55
1F:推 birdy590: 你自己都讲出答案了 10/08 01:34
2F:→ yoche2000: 不是 我是想知道背後有没有理由这样做啊 10/08 11:53
3F:→ yoche2000: 为什麽不用 eth 的 tag field 就好 10/08 11:54
4F:推 goodyW: 应该跟处理的loading有关,不一样的栏位,如果变成你讲的 10/08 13:46
5F:→ goodyW: 就是要全部loading进去,徒增处理长度 10/08 13:47
6F:推 birdy590: 建议原po去查一下cisco pvst系列协定的发展史 10/08 18:27
7F:推 birdy590: native vlan问题一堆 还不如不带tag 10/08 18:29
8F:→ birdy590: ieee标准这边从头到尾都是untagged 10/08 18:30
9F:→ yoche2000: 诶 请教birdy大 要找发展史要去哪里看呢 如果找 doc 应 10/11 12:56
10F:→ yoche2000: 该会是最後的版本 10/11 12:56
12F:→ birdy590: 在知乎看过中文的文件 开始专属协定是带tag的 10/11 20:03
13F:→ birdy590: 但是没有任何好处还造成很多麻烦 10/11 20:04